Woman rescued from fire at 'hoarder house' on Detroit's west side

DETROIT (WXYZ) — A woman was rescued from a fire at what crews are calling a hoarder house on Detroit's west side Wednesday.

The fire was at a residence at Woodstock Drive and Litchfield.

Firefighters say they had to climb over a mountain of trash to rescue a woman trapped in a fire. When crews got there, they found garbage piled high in every room, making the rescue almost impossible.

They finally got her out and performed CPR to save her.

Her current condition is unknown.
